This economy is going to go through a very rude awakening as we step into an environment that is less friendly regarding low borrowing costs and stimulus. We are stepping into an interest rate hike environment where its harder to obtain bank loans, mortgages, business loans, credit cards and borrowing costs will continue to rise. This will pose a very big problem for a majority of Americans regardless of your financial status. If you were a home seller would you sell a home now or wait? I would bet you would likely want to sell a home now as its more likely you could get more as there would be a larger pool of buyers that could afford to purchase your home at todays market levels vs when rates continue to go up and so will the would be mortgage payments. This is generally when home prices start to come down to meet property buyers affordability.
